Output de49c14dceb8671d7dcd137e770d9313fbcbbf7cae9e589291bf8da360406576:35

value
26287104
script pubkey
OP_0 OP_PUSHBYTES_20 2d3fd31c880ad13467c57af6da964c133bafc40d
address
bc1q95lax8ygptgnge790tmd49jvzva6l3qdp0exxs
transaction
de49c14dceb8671d7dcd137e770d9313fbcbbf7cae9e589291bf8da360406576
confirmations
273030
spent
true